Definition of excessive

adjective
  1. beyond normal limits; "excessive charges"; "a book of inordinate length"; "his dress stops just short of undue elegance"; "unreasonable demands"
  2. unrestrained, especially with regard to feelings; "extravagant praise"; "exuberant compliments"; "overweening ambition"; "overweening greed"

What are synonyms for excessive?
Synonyms for excessive include: extravagant, exuberant, immoderate, inordinate, overweening, undue, unreasonable, unrestrained.
